Template:External Template:Infobox Build A compost bin is a Dragonwilds:Farming object that players can create to turn unwanted items (Dragonwilds:burnt food, vegetables, and other acceptable items) into Dragonwilds:compost. It takes five seconds to convert a compostable item into compost. Once compost has been processed at the bottom of the bin, players must wield their Dragonwilds:compost bucket before interacting and filling it with compost.

Note that players cannot destroy their compost bin whilst there is compost stored inside.

Level 10 Dragonwilds:Farming is required to unlock the recipe.

Compostable items

List of acceptable items that players can place inside the bin:

Compostable item Compost value
Any Dragonwilds:burnt food +10
Dragonwilds:Bloodwood sap +10
Dragonwilds:Shocking plant bulb +10
Dragonwilds:Animal bone +10
Dragonwilds:Small animal fang +10
Dragonwilds:Monstrous fang +10
Dragonwilds:Antler +10
Any herb (except Dragonwilds:irit) +10
Dragonwilds:Anima-infused bark +10
Dragonwilds:Wheat +10
Dragonwilds:Feathers +10
Any plants +10
Any logs +10
Any raw food +1
